Technical Characteristics of Asus Transfromer Pro T304 Repuestos
The Asus Transformer Pro T304 is a portable PC with exceptional flexibility and high potential for repair and repuestos (replacement parts). Here are some of the key technical characteristics:
- Display: 12.6" LED-backlit Full HD+ (2880 by 1920) display.
- Processor: Intel® Core™ i7 7500U Processor.
- Graphics: Integrated Intel HD Graphics 620.
- Memory: 16 GB LPDDR3 2133MHz.
- Storage: Solid state drive (SSD) up to 1 TB.
- Wireless Technology: 802.11 ac Wi-Fi, Bluetooth® 4.1.
- Camera: 2 MP front, and 5 MP rear camera.
- Operating System: Windows 10 Pro.
Instructions for Replacing Asus Transfromer Pro T304 Repuestos
Be sure to power off your device and unplug it from any power source before starting a repair. Work on a static-free environment to avoid causing any electrical damage to the device.
Replacing the Battery
- Remove the back cover using a plastic opening tool or a thin, flat object.
- Disconnect the battery connector from the motherboard by lifting it out gently.
- Unscrew the screws holding the battery in place. Lift the battery out of its slot.
- Position the new battery within the slot, then screw it securely.
- Reconnect the battery connector to the motherboard. Carefully reposition the back cover and snap it into place.
Replacing the Display
- First, remove the back cover using a plastic opening tool.
- Disconnect the display connector from the motherboard. Unscrew the screws around the display frame.
- Gently remove the display from the device.
- Position the new display correctly and screw it into the frame.
- Reconnect the display connector to the motherboard and carefully put the back cover.
Replacing the Storage (SSD)
- After opening the back cover, locate the SSD. It's often secured by a cover held down by one or two screws.
- After unscrewing and removing the cover, remove the SSD by unscrewing it and gently pulling it out of its socket.
- Insert the new SSD properly within its slot. Secure it with a screw, replace the SSD cover, and resecure it.
- Reattach the back cover to your device.
